Interests
The interests of the group are centered around materials chemistry, with three main research streams: (i) functional nanomaterials for drug delivery and sensors; (ii) structure and interfacial behaviour of nanoparticles; (iii) plastics and their impact in environmental pollution. In the latest research the team is also developing an interest in the artificial weathering of plastic, their characterisation and the evaluation of their impact on human health.
